This week is part two of our conversation with our co-host Abby De Groot along with our friends Rikki Brons and Gayle Doornbos as they share about their adventure this summer on pilgrimage on the Camino de Santiago in Spain. We recommend that you go back and listen to our last episode before diving into part two of the conversation. In this part of the conversation, we focus on what pilgrimage is, what it is all about, and how pilgrimage might even be educational—an adventure in pedagogy. We discuss the difference between pilgrimage and “going for a walk,” the role of community in our pilgrimage through life, and the way Christian educators might benefit from thinking about teaching as a sort of pilgrimage–walking on the way and seeking to faithfully follow Jesus.
